Doug,

I did Calgary to New Brunswick solo with a 3-yr old and a van I didn’t yet know - we flew out to Calgary to pick-it up and to “hunt dinosaurs”. Neither the boy or the ’88 Westy melted down on the return trip - though Northern Ontario had both of them at their limits (maybe the boy moreso than the van).

As long as no-one is in a hurry and there are plenty of play spots, kids love travelling in the van.
